Solution for 13y-10=-17y+20 equation:


Simplifying
13y + -10 = -17y + 20

Reorder the terms:
-10 + 13y = -17y + 20

Reorder the terms:
-10 + 13y = 20 + -17y

Solving
-10 + 13y = 20 + -17y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'17y' to each side of the equation.
-10 + 13y + 17y = 20 + -17y + 17y

Combine like terms: 13y + 17y = 30y
-10 + 30y = 20 + -17y + 17y

Combine like terms: -17y + 17y = 0
-10 + 30y = 20 + 0
-10 + 30y = 20

Add '10' to each side of the equation.
-10 + 10 + 30y = 20 + 10

Combine like terms: -10 + 10 = 0
0 + 30y = 20 + 10
30y = 20 + 10

Combine like terms: 20 + 10 = 30
30y = 30

Divide each side by '30'.
y = 1

Simplifying
y = 1
